Job Overview
We are looking for a responsible and experienced Store Cum Operations Manager to manage the complete store and day-to-day operational activities of our interior designing and manufacturing factory. The candidate will be responsible for inventory management, material handling, procurement coordination, manpower coordination and smooth factory operations.
Key Responsibilities
Store & Inventory Management
Manage day-to-day operations of the factory store.
Maintain proper records of raw materials, hardware, furniture materials, welding materials, fibre/FRP and GRC materials.
Handle inward and outward movement of materials.
Check quantity and quality of materials received from vendors.
Maintain stock registers and ensure accurate inventory records.
Monitor minimum stock levels and coordinate for timely replenishment.
Prevent material wastage, damage and unauthorized usage.
Conduct regular physical stock verification and reconcile discrepancies.
Ensure proper storage and arrangement of materials for easy identification and access.
Factory Operations
Supervise and coordinate daily factory operations.
Coordinate with production supervisors, carpenters, welders, fabricators and other workers.
Ensure materials are issued to production teams as per requirements.
Monitor workflow and ensure smooth movement of materials from store to production.
Coordinate with management and the design/project team regarding material and production requirements.
Ensure work is completed within the required timelines.
Handle day-to-day operational issues and coordinate with concerned departments for solutions.
Purchase & Vendor Coordination
Coordinate with the purchase team/vendors for required materials.
Compare material requirements with available stock before placing orders.
Follow up with vendors regarding deliveries and pending materials.
Check received materials against purchase orders/invoices.
Maintain proper documentation of purchases and material receipts.
Team & Administration
Manage and coordinate store staff and supporting workers.
Maintain discipline and proper work practices within the store and factory.
Prepare daily/weekly reports related to stock and operations.
Ensure proper cleanliness, safety and organization of the store and work areas.
Report stock shortages, damages, wastage and operational issues to management.
